It’s like someone whispered the magic words to me: what if U2’s 2023 album Songs of Surrender was a ballet? Ask and you shall receive. On the 30th anniversary of Complexions Ballet Company, the troupe is putting a contemporary spin on classical ballet and reinterpreting the Irish lads’ latest release for the stage. Dwight Rhoden has put together an immersive dance piece – titled “For Crying Out Loud” – with 16 performers that push boundaries.
